Versions

OpenAPI Explorer manages the versions of the DBS API by version number. You can select the API version based on the features that you want to use.

Note

2019-03-06 indicates a version number of the API rather than the date when the API was last updated. You are provided with the latest API data in each version.

API version

Description

2019-03-06

Provides features including backup task management, restore task management, and backup set download. For more information about the API operations that are supported by this version, see List of operations by function.

2021-01-01

Provides features including sandbox instance management and advanced download of ApsaraDB RDS instances. For more information about the API operations that are supported by this version, see List of operations by function.

Endpoints

You can select an endpoint based on the region in which your resource resides to reduce latency. For example, if your DBS resides in the China (Zhangjiakou) region, the public endpoint is dbs-api.cn-zhangjiakou.aliyuncs.com, and the Virtual Private Cloud (VPC) endpoint is dbs-api-vpc.cn-zhangjiakou.aliyuncs.com.

  • Public endpoints can be globally accessed.

  • Each VPC is identified by using a unique tunnel ID, which corresponds to a virtualized network. The following section describes the benefits of VPC endpoints:

    • Higher security: VPC endpoints can be accessed only within a VPC. This provides higher security and privacy.

    • Faster response: VPC endpoints use the internal network environment to deliver faster responses than those of public endpoints. In addition, by using VPC endpoints, you are free from issues such as network latency and bandwidth limits.

    • Lower cost: VPC endpoints are accessed over an internal network.

For more information, see Endpoints.

Supported user identities

After you log on to OpenAPI Explorer by using your Alibaba Cloud account, OpenAPI Explorer uses your Alibaba Cloud account to perform online debugging by default. An Alibaba Cloud account has permissions on all API operations. Security risks may arise if you use an Alibaba Cloud account to debug API operations online. We recommend that you call API operations or perform routine O&M as a Resource Access Management (RAM) user. Before you call API operations as a RAM user, grant the required permissions to the RAM user based on your business requirements. The RAM user must have the permissions to manage DBS. For more information, see RAM authorization.

Alibaba Cloud SDKs

  • Alibaba Cloud provides SDKs in multiple programming languages, such as Java, C#, Go, Python, Node.js, TypeScript, PHP, and C++. SDKs free you from considering the implementation details of API operations, and standardize the identity, authentication, and signing rules. You need to only integrate SDKs and use the SDKs to directly call API operations. For more information, see Alibaba Cloud SDKs.

  • You can use Alibaba Cloud SDKs to call API operations of DBS. For more information, see List of operations by function.

Alibaba Cloud CLI

  • Alibaba Cloud CLI allows you to run aliyun commands in the CLI shell to interact with Alibaba Cloud services and manage cloud service resources. For more information, see What is Alibaba Cloud CLI?

  • You can use Alibaba Cloud CLI to call API operations of DBS. For more information, see Call RPC API and RESTful API.

Custom encapsulation

You can encapsulate API requests based on your business requirements to call API operations. To make native HTTP calls, you must construct custom requests and sign the requests. For more information, see Request syntax and signature method V3.
